Will it actually fit your rack without extra hassle?
This is the primary risk. The regret moment usually happens before first use, when buyers realize the mount may fit the recovery boards but still not line up cleanly with their roof rail or MOLLE pattern.
The pattern appears persistent across universal-fit hardware categories, and it feels more disruptive than expected here because the product promises broad compatibility with multiple surfaces.
During setup, the problem gets worse if your rail spacing is unusual or your accessory rail is not the exact style implied by the listing.
Compared with a typical mid-range board mount, this asks for more pre-purchase checking, which raises the chance of buying first and measuring later.
- Early sign: You start measuring rail width, slot shape, and bolt spacing after ordering instead of before.
- Frequency tier: Primary issue because universal-fit claims commonly create the biggest mismatch risk in this category.
- Root cause: Broad compatibility language covers boards and vehicles, but not every rack layout behaves the same.
- Buyer impact: Extra time goes into test fitting, repositioning, or deciding whether to return it.
- Fix attempt: Careful measuring before purchase helps, but the listing still leaves some real-world fit questions open.
- Hidden requirement: You need to know your exact rail or MOLLE dimensions, not just your vehicle name.
Could the “rattle-free” promise depend too much on your setup?
- Pattern note: This looks like a secondary issue, not universal, but noise control in these mounts often depends heavily on precise installation.
- When it shows up: After setup, it becomes obvious on rough roads, trail vibration, or daily driving with boards mounted full time.
- Why it frustrates: Rattle claims create a higher expectation than a normal mount, so any noise feels worse than standard category compromise.
- Likely cause: Pad placement and clamping tension can vary by board brand, board wear, and mounting surface.
- What buyers notice: Small movement, tapping sounds, or the need to retighten after the first drives.
- Why this exceeds baseline: Typical mid-range options may not promise silence so strongly, which makes minor vibration easier to accept.
- Fixability: Sometimes manageable, but it adds tuning effort that many shoppers do not expect at this price.

Who should avoid this

- Avoid it if you want a true bolt-on install with minimal measuring, because compatibility checking appears heavier than normal.
- Avoid it if your rack or MOLLE setup is non-standard, since universal claims do not remove layout-specific fit risk.
- Avoid it if price sensitivity matters and you only carry recovery boards occasionally.
- Avoid it if noise or movement would bother you and you do not want trial-and-error adjustment after installation.
Who this is actually good for

- Good fit for buyers who already know their rail dimensions and can verify compatibility before ordering.
- Good fit for owners building a semi-permanent overland setup where extra install time is acceptable.
- Good fit for shoppers who value the included hardware and are comfortable fine-tuning clamp pressure and pad placement.
- Good fit if your main goal is a lighter mount and you are willing to trade easy universality for setup homework.

Safer alternatives

- Choose vehicle-specific or rack-specific mounts if your main fear is fit uncertainty.
- Look for listings with exact slot spacing or hole measurements to reduce hidden homework.
- Prefer simpler clamp systems if your boards are removed often and you want less tuning for noise control.
- Buy narrower-fit mounts when possible, because less universal language often means fewer surprises.
The bottom line

The main regret trigger is not build quality on paper. It is the gap between universal-fit expectations and the real measuring, matching, and adjustment some buyers will still need.
That risk is higher than normal for this category because the product promises broad compatibility across boards and mounting surfaces. If you cannot verify your rack layout before buying, this is easier to skip than gamble on.
